The first person on the moon was Neil Armstrong.
To date only men have been to the moon.
The first men to visit the moon were Frank Borman, James Lovell, and William Anders in their Apollo 8 spacecraft. They did not land on the moon, however. Their mission was only to fly to and orbit the moon, proving the equipment could perform as needed.
The Apollo program were the only manned lunar missions.
